The Fürstenwalde zoo is home to around 330 animals of 80 different species and offers fascinating insights into the local and exotic animal kingdom. European species such as bison, red deer, fallow deer and mouflon as well as foxes and lynxes characterize the zoo. The diversity is complemented by exotic animals such as Bennett's kangaroos, marmosets and dwarf otters. A special highlight is the impressive collection of birds of prey and owls, including majestic species such as golden eagles, sea eagles and steppe eagles as well as the smallest native owl, the little owl.

The petting zoo with sheep and goats offers a special experience for children, while a snack bar with adjoining playground invites them to relax. The zoo school and environmental meeting place organizes curriculum-related teaching units for pupils in grades 1 to 13. For organizational reasons, group visits require registration at least three working days before the planned date.

Comfort Information

  • Leisuretime
    Visitor parking
    • Distance of visitor parking to the entrance (in meters, approx.): 50
    Flooring
    • Partly restricted walkable flooring (inside and/or outside)
    Stairs
    • Everything is accessible at ground level / without stairs.
    Guest bathroom
    • Guest toilet is accessible without stairs
    Additional info
    • Convenient arrival by public transport possible
    • Supplementary information:
      • Disabled WC available.
      • Disabled parking spaces directly in front of the entrance.
      • Guide dogs are welcome.
      • Paved sandy path that can be used without restrictions.
